[QUOTE="RoanDurham, post: 1136980, member: 22389"] Had a friend ask me what she should do with the extra grass she has on her place. They downsized in the past and now have more much more grass than they can handle. I wasn't quite sure what would be the most profitable right now so I figured I'd ask you guys. One stipulation was that she wanted to sell whatever she bought before winter. If you had extra grass would you: 1) buy heavy breds, calve them out and then sell the pair in the fall 2) buy open heifers, breed and sell late fall 3) ? [/QUOTE]
